The inbuilt Make AI Assistant can help in configuring use of the HTTP
module.
If the API documentation includes a CURL example, you can ask it to create a corresponding HTTP module in your scenario.
Depending on how the API documentation is worded, you might even be able to copy text from the documentation and ask the AI Assistant to create a corresponding HTTP module.
